The SYKD Hunt Vindicate XVC Crossbow Package delivers a powerful 380 fps shot velocity, equipped with an adjustable tactical buttstock and ambidextrous trigger safety for personalized comfort and secure handling. Featuring a 4x32 illuminated scope with interchangeable red and blue reticles, plus a durable aluminum flight rail, this full package is designed to elevate your hunting or target shooting experience with professional-grade performance and reliability.

Not for shorties
The bow is awesome, the range shots are only 20 yards but got it sighted in and took it out twice in the yard. I am only 5'6 and i have to leg lock and arch my back to get the thing cocked. Reason for refund is that, the reason for the return was because the limb cracked as soon as it was cocked in the backyard. Lesson, if you're 5'6 or shorter get less of a powerstroke (i went to the local shop and got a wicked ridge blackhawk 360 so 13.5 powerstroke VS the 15 this has, didn't think inch and a half would be a big deal but boy was i wrong

Easy to assemble the main crossbow, the instructions could be a little better on cranking device
It was very easy to assemble, I was very curious how I was going to get it with it strung and it wasn’t a problem at all, the only issue I had was with the cranking device. When looking at the instructions I messed up and missed a step when you put the string of the cranking device in a groove near the bottom of the sight and tried to use the cranking device incorrectly, tying several knots in the string at my negligence and ruined the device. It was not a total inconvenience because I could crank the bow with my hands, but maybe a bigger more zoomed out picture in the instructions would help? I also thing that a product could be made where y’all just make plastic hooks with no string that people can use to crank the bow. Overall I think it’s a great looking and performing crossbow, and they did a lot of things right, but I think they could make the instructions a little more clear

went through 3 limb replacements
I bought it in August, shot it ten times and a limb cracked. i took it to a Bowhunter Superstore near my house and they replaced the limb. they pulled the string back and the new limb cracked. They put the 3rd limb on and pulled it back and shot it once. they said they didn't want to shoot another arrow because they were afraid it would crack again. They said they will never sell another Sykd bow. all they have is problems. Now i need to try to get my money back from the company for the repair costs that i have into it and try to get my money back for the bow. i don't trust it. Clearly inferior material used for the limbs. i'm not the only one with the issue apparently. When the manufacturer sends their dealers extra replacement limbs to have in stock, you know there is an issue.
